Mazda 6 TS2 Diesel 143 - Big ends knocking - rtj70

Does the car even have a DPF if it's a 2006 engine? I guess it probably does because the earlier diesel was 136PS?

The problems normally associated with DPF problems on a Mazda is oil level rising due to diesel diluting the oil. The oil is spec'd to cope with this if you use the correct oil. But things can be wrong if the oil gets too high.

HJ does say: "Early diesels can suffer big end failure"
